[Memorial plaque to Captain C. F. Hall.] Photographer: Mitchell, Thomas
Scope & Content:
Genre: Historical Events Close view of brass plaque to the memory of Captain C. F. Hall, erected by members of the Nares Expedition of 1875-6. Hall, from the U.S. Ship 'Polaris', died during an earlier expedition on 8 November 1871.
